Pathophysiology of autoimmune polyneuropathies.

The most common autoimmune neuropathies include the acute inflammatory polyneuropathy [the Guillain-Barré Syndrome(s)]; chronic inflammatory demyelinating polyneuropathy (CIDP), multifocal motor neuropathy (MMN) and IgM anti-MAG-antibody mediated paraproteinemic neuropathy. Differentiation antigens in acute leukaemia.

The heterogeneity of the haemopoietic cell system has been recognized for many years because of the diversity of functional and morphological differences between various cell types. This is particularly well exemplified in the clinical expression of various leukaemias where the morphological appearance, clinical presentation and response to therapy are a reflection of the leukaemic cell type.
